Prince William has expressed his condolences over the death of Edward Pettifer, his former nanny's stepson who was killed in the New Orleans terror attack.

Edward was among the 14 people killed when a pick-up truck donning an ISIS flag mowed down new year revelers in the early hours. The Prince of Wales and Kate said they were "shocked and saddened" by the 31-year-old's death.

Edward's stepmum, Alexandra Pettifer, was employed as a nanny for young Prince William and Prince Harry in the 1990s, when she was known as Tiggy Legge-Bourke.

Prince William's statement read: "Our thoughts and prayers remain with the Pettifer family and all those innocent people who have been tragically impacted by this horrific attack."

Edward was visiting Louisiana with a friend when the tragedy struck. His cause of death has been confirmed as "blunt force injuries". His friend also died in the attack.

The vehicle hit many people before driver Shamsud-Din Jabbar,42, a US army veteran, opened fire. At least 14 people are confirmed dead with dozens left injured. Police shot and killed Jabbar at the scene.

Edward's grieving relatives paid tribute to their "wonderful son, brother, grandson, nephew and a friend to many".

In a statement, they added that they "devastated at the tragic news of Ed's death in New Orleans".

It continued: "We will all miss him terribly. Our thoughts are with the other families who have lost their family members due to this terrible attack.

"We request that we can grieve the loss of Ed as a family in private. Thank you."

It's understood Prince William remained in contact with Alexandra remained in contact to this day, long after she stopped nannying in 1999.

It's also understood Alexandra played a significant role in the two royal boys' lives after the death of their mother, Princess Diana, in 1997, and that the former nanny is godmother to Harry and Meghan's son, Archie.
